Ara's Managed Automotive Apprenticeships offer tailored, work-based learning for those entering or advancing within the automotive industry. Apprenticeships are structured via night classes and workplace visits, focusing on upskilling with trade qualifications such as the Certificate in Automotive Engineering (Level 3) and progressing to the Certificate in Light Automotive Engineering (Level 4). Apprentices develop technical know-how while working and receiving guidance from industry professionals.
What you need to know first
Employment in the automotive industry (for entry to apprenticeship)
Pathway options: no prior qualification, significant industry experience, or Level 3 qualification in automotive engineering
